Early upshifting
Got my stupid 85 GT (Auto, CFI) Running again. I took it out for a drive today, and the damn thing upshifted at 2000RPM under WOT. My guess would be the kickdown is out of adjustment, right? Its the solid linkage (Not a cable) Is there a proper way to adjust this? I ended up holding the poor thing in first just to be safe. (I hear its easy to **** em up if the Kickdown is out of adjustment) Am I thinking pretty clear? Is there a proper way to adjust the damn thing?
#2
RE: Early upshifting
check to see if the bolt fell out of the kickdown rod..my 85 used to be cfi with an aod...... the proper way is to have a pressure gauge hooked into the test port and place it in gear and set rod length until pressure falls into spec......however i SET mine to feel and you can get it close enough... there should be a rod down to the tranny from the THrottle linkage that is adjustable......adjust it is small increments and test drive it until it feels right at the setting you put it at
